What Is the Drive Air Mattress 14026 and How Does It Work?
The Drive Air Mattress 14026 is a medical-grade therapeutic air mattress designed for patients at risk of bedsores or pressure ulcers. This mattress employs alternating pressure technology to relieve pressure on the skin and improve blood circulation.
According to the American Journal of Nursing, therapeutic air mattresses are essential in preventing complications in patients with limited mobility. The Drive Air Mattress specifically provides support through its adjustable air chamber system.
This air mattress consists of a multi-chamber design that alternates air pressure in individual cells. This action redistributes body weight and reduces pressure points, promoting better skin health. The device is powered by an electric pump, which maintains the required pressure levels.

How Do You Set Up the Drive Air Mattress 14026 Step by Step?
To set up the Drive Air Mattress 14026 properly, follow these steps: unpack the mattress, connect the pump, position the mattress on the bed frame, plug in the pump, and adjust the settings.
-
Unpacking the mattress: Carefully remove the Drive Air Mattress 14026 from its packaging. Lay it flat on a clean surface. Ensure the mattress is not punctured or damaged during unpacking.
-
Connecting the pump: Locate the air pump that comes with the mattress. Use the provided hose to connect the pump’s air outlet to the mattress inlet. Secure the connection to prevent air leaks.
-
Positioning the mattress: Place the mattress on the bed frame. Adjust the mattress so it fits snugly in the frame. Ensure the air mattress is level and not hanging over the edges.
-
Plugging in the pump: Insert the pump’s power cord into an electrical outlet. Make sure the outlet is functioning and within easy reach to avoid pulling on the cords during use.
-
Adjusting the settings: Turn on the pump using the power button. Set the desired pressure level via the control panel. The mattress will inflate automatically and achieve the set comfort level. Monitor the inflating process for any irregularities.
These steps ensure that the Drive Air Mattress 14026 is set up correctly for optimal comfort and support. Regular maintenance and checking for air leaks will prolong the life of the mattress.

What Troubleshooting Steps Should You Follow for Common Issues with the Drive Air Mattress 14026?
To troubleshoot common issues with the Drive Air Mattress 14026, follow these steps:
- Check the power supply.
- Inspect for leaks.
- Examine the control unit.
- Assess the mattress connections.
- Confirm correct settings.
- Review the inflation status.
These main points guide a structured approach to addressing issues with the Drive Air Mattress. Understanding these steps will help you identify the root cause of the problem.
-
Check the Power Supply: Checking the power supply involves ensuring the mattress is plugged in and that the outlet is working. A malfunctioning outlet can prevent the mattress from inflating. Use a different device to verify the outlet’s functionality.
-
Inspect for Leaks: Inspecting for leaks entails visually examining the mattress for any punctures or tears. You can also use soapy water to identify escaping air bubbles. Small punctures can be repaired with air mattress patches.
-
Examine the Control Unit: Examining the control unit involves checking for any visible damage or indicator lights. A malfunctioning control panel can affect the inflation levels. If the unit is unresponsive, refer to the user manual for reset procedures.
-
Assess the Mattress Connections: Assessing the mattress connections means ensuring all hoses and connectors are securely attached. Loose connections can lead to air loss and inadequate inflation. Tighten all fittings to secure airflow.
-
Confirm Correct Settings: Confirming correct settings includes reviewing the desired pressure settings on the control unit. User preferences may require adjustments for comfort. Adjust settings incrementally and monitor for changes.
-
Review the Inflation Status: Reviewing the inflation status requires checking if the mattress is fully inflated. Depending on use, it may take several minutes to reach optimal firmness. If the mattress does not inflate properly, consider restarting the unit.
By systematically approaching these steps, you can effectively resolve issues with the Drive Air Mattress 14026 while ensuring an understanding of each component’s role in the mattress functionality.
